Any person aggrieved by any action of the board refusing to grant, or suspending or revoking, a certificate of registration or a permit for any cause, may, within fifteen days following notification by the board of such action, appeal to the superior court of the county wherein he resides, and, after hearing, said court shall make such decree, sustaining or reversing in whole or in part the decree of the board, as it deems proper, and its decision shall be final.
Mass. Gen. Laws ch. 112, § 81S
